Our client is one of the country’s leading professional services firms. In their central London office, they’re growing their Technology Team and are looking for a Support Analyst to join them. You’ll work closely with end users and stakeholders across the business, logging, managing, and owning incidents and proactively monitoring IT issues. You’ll be the first point of contact for all tech support and work to solve user problems proactively, diagnose and resolve technical hardware and software issues and be key in implementing continuous improvements to systems and workflows.
Requirements:
- Experience in a similar Helpdesk / EUC / L1 IT Support role
- Good knowledge of Windows and Mac desktops and devices
- Microsoft 365 experience
- MDM knowledge – Android and iPhone
- Proven knowledge of MS applications – Word, Excel, PowerPoint, Teams, SharePoint etc
- Excellent communication skills and a positive, proactive manner
- Networking and IT security fundamentals would be ideal
